Obviously the Main Stand will remain and be preserved for future generations but, even with all my memories of the rest of the stadium, it would be fantastic to modernise and bring Ibrox fully into the 21st century.

The stadium in Brisbane, Lang Park/Suncorp Stadium, is probably the best rectangular ground I have been to. The concourse between upper and lower tiers is open to the pitch so rather than the food and drink outlets being under the stands they are on huge wide open spaces where you can still see the pitch. It's a great design feature.

They don't have to sell out, anything over 45000 and they are making more money than us, anything over 50000 which they have had on European nights is money we can never earn.

Over the last 18 years they have averaged 53000, we have averaged 46000. 7000 tickets x 19 league matches over the course of the 18 years at say £20 a ticket is £47,880,000. Fag packet maths maybe but still shows the huge gulf that exists. If we had increased back then it will have paid for itself and some by now.
